		<description>BagFilter: Can anyone recommend a backpack for short people? I am short and most backpacks are too long for my torso.  &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; I am looking for a bag to carry to work and school. I am 5&apos;0&apos;. Most bags are designed for people with some length on their torso and then either hurt or look funny. I tried messenger bags, but these are also kind of large. Any bags for short/petite people?</description>

		<description>I&apos;m not the same size but I searched for months (possibly years) for a comfortable backpack for day hikes -- settling finally on Millet. The first rule to finding a backpack was to select a size first (expressed usually in liters) then start the winnowing from there. People who use a pack for daily commuting tend to wear packs incorrectly. What struck me with the Millet was the adjustability -- to get the pack fitting snug to my back and riding nicely at the hips.  Caveat: I shopped for a pack in Paris where day packs  and the culture of day hiking is strong.</description>

		<description>go to the &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.mec.ca&quot;&gt;Mountain Equipment Co-op&lt;/a&gt; website; they are a canadian outdoor store, and many of their bags come in &apos;short&apos; &apos;regular&apos; and &apos;tall&apos; sizes. (And yes, lots of their bags are work/school appropriate.)&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
Either that or perhaps there are some non-childish-looking bags for children that you could use? You&apos;re the same height as a lot of 12 year olds. Maybe try some specialty/higher end childrens stores? (I say higher end because seems they&apos;d be more likely to have more sophisticated looking bags. Just a guess though.)</description>

		<description>more expensive makes have different designs for women (which tend to assume shorter bodies and different strap shapes, as well as &quot;prettier&quot; colours).  also, some have adjustable backs, but that tends to be larger capacities.  you&apos;re probably best going to a good quality walking/outdoor shop.</description>
